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$39,040 |
25th Percentile Wage | $49,200 |
50th Percentile Wage | $63,720 |
75th Percentile Wage | $80,190 |
90th Percentile Wage | $99,890 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for writers and editors in the industry of credit intermediation and related activities.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) writers and editors is $99,890.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$63,720.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ent writers and editors is $39,040.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of writers and editors in the industry of Credit Intermediation and Related Activities from 2012 to 2017.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2017 | $63,720 | -0.14% | 20.46% |
2016 | $63,810 | 4.20% | - |
2015 | $61,130 | -4.37% | - |
2014 | $63,800 | 13.90% | - |
2013 | $54,930 | 7.74% | - |
2012 | $50,680 | - | - |
